What is the cheapest London to Marsa Alam flight route?

Data is based on round-trip flight searches on KAYAK over the past month.

The cheapest return flight from London to Marsa Alam costs £565 on the route between London Gatwick Airport (LGW) and Marsa Alam (RMF). It is also the most popular route.

What is the cheapest month to fly from London to Marsa Alam?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from London to Marsa Alam,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from London to Marsa Alam is August, where tickets cost £0 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and April,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is £570 and £540 respectively.

Can I save money by flying with a stopover from London to Marsa Alam?

The average return price for all direct flights, flights with one stopover, and flights with two stopovers for the route found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

Yes, flying with a stopover may cost you more time, but you can also save money on the route, with a 1 stop stopover the cheapest option at £403 on average.

  • Which airports will I be using when flying from London to Marsa Alam?

    There are 5 airports in London (London Gatwick, London Heathrow, London Luton, London Southend, and London Stansted.) and only 1 airport in Marsa Alam (Marsa Alam). The cheapest flights are generally found on the London Luton Airport to Marsa Alam flight route.
